Title: Innovator Thomas Villiam Sejer Mikkelsen: Pioneering Vacuum Insulated Glass Technologies

Introduction: Thomas Villiam Sejer Mikkelsen is an accomplished inventor residing in Hørsholm, Denmark. With a remarkable record of 8 patents to his name, Mikkelsen focuses on innovative solutions in the field of building materials, particularly through advancements in vacuum insulated glass technologies. His contributions are set to revolutionize the standards of energy efficiency and insulation in windows and doors.

Latest Patents: Mikkelsen's most recent inventions include a building aperture cover, such as a window or door, that features a flexible gasket with a sealed cavity. This unique design integrates a vacuum insulated glass unit, enhancing the thermal performance of the building structure. Additionally, he has developed a method for providing laminated vacuum insulated glass (VIG) units, streamlining the production process while ensuring superior insulation properties. These patents illustrate his dedication to improving building materials and energy efficiency.
